  • Back for another flight of the Nexa Hellcat with a 9cc NGH Gas Engine with all the maiden kinks worked out. This Hellcat takes a .50 size electric or gas option and has a 1570mm (60.4") wingspan, constructed primarily from balsa wood and covered with a fuel-resistant covering.     Hey thanks for making this great video! I appreciate you showing how non-intimidating gas planes are. It really is easy as long as you pay attention to a few basics on setup, and the flight times are unbeatable! To fortify your cowl mount system, here are two techniques you will find helpful. First, glue some CA hinge material to the INSIDE of the cowl right over each screw hole using thin CA and a bit of accelerator. This will make the part of the cowl near the screws much less prone to cracking and wear. You first start with just a few drops of CA and hold the hinge material down with a thin blade until it stays. Then, completely soak it with CA and use some benchcraft accelerator! Second, go to any Home Depot or Lowes and look in the plumbing section for some number 60 O-rings. Put one on each cowl mounting screw and then install the screw onto the cowl and torque it down until it just starts to press down on the O-ring and the cowl does not move. This will keep the screw head from wearing away the fiberglass over time. Happy flying!
